Retrospective ECG Overread
To review and adjudicate ECG Analysis results, follow these steps:
- Navigate to the Patients List:
- Select the “Patients” button from the blue left navigation menu. This will display a list of all patients or participants currently assigned ECG patches.
- Select a Patient/Participant:
- Click on the name of a specific patient or participant to bring up a list, organized by day, of all incidents that have been detected for that individual.
- Review Daily Data:
- Click on a specific day to view the data and analysis for that day. This allows you to examine the recorded ECG data in detail.
- Reviewing ECG Events (Event View)
- The events list shows all the categorized ECG events, depending on how the Monitoring Protocol was configured. If there are multiple incidents, they will be grouped by type. Click on the drop-down arrow to expand the listed events.
- A red dot will be placed before each event's name to identify unreviewed events. When a Web Portal user views an event, the red dot will be removed from everyone's view.
- When you click on an event, the ECG Full Disclosure View shows the ECG waveform, which is marked with vertical green lines showing the beginning and end of the event.
- You can scroll or click on the arrows to move to the left or right of the detected event to view the context or onset/offset of the rhythm abnormalities.
